Patent number: 7536623Abstract: A low density parity check (LDPC) code generating method and apparatus are provided. A parity check matrix with (N?K) rows for check nodes and N columns for variable nodes are formed to encode an information sequence of length K to a codeword of length N. The parity check matrix is divided into an information part matrix with K columns and a parity part matrix with (N?k) columns. The parity part is divided into P×P subblocks. P is a divisor of (N?K). First and second diagonals are defined in the parity part matrix and the second diagonal is a shift of the first diagonal by f subblocks. Shifted identity matrices are placed on the first and second diagonals and zero matrices are filled elsewhere. An odd number of delta matrices each having only one element of 1 are placed in one subblock column of the parity part matrix. The parity check matrix is stored.Type: GrantFiled: November 30, 2005Date of Patent: May 19, 2009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Sang-Hyo Kim, Han-Ju Kim, Min-Goo Kim, Young-Mo Gu

Patent number: 7454685Abstract: A method and apparatus are provided for decoding an LDPC code including a plurality of check nodes and a plurality of variable nodes. The apparatus includes a check node selection scheduler that selects at least one of the check nodes, an LLR memory that stores an input LLR value for the variable nodes as an initial LLR value and stores updated LLR values for variable nodes connected to the selected check node, and a check node message memory that stores a check node message indicating a result value of check node processing on the selected check node. The apparatus further includes at least one united node processor that generates a variable node message by subtracting the check node message of the selected check node from corresponding LLR values read from the LLR memory, performs check node processing on the variable node message, calculates an LLR value updated by adding the variable node message to the check node processing result value, and delivers the calculated LLR value to the LLR memory.Type: GrantFiled: November 22, 2005Date of Patent: November 18, 2008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Sang-Hyo Kim, Sung-Jin Park, Han-Ju Kim, Min-Goo Kim
